Body

Origins and Family

Jonathan Gathorne-Hardy's place of birth was Edinburgh[2]. Recorded date of birth include +1933-01-01T00:00:00Z[3] and +1933-05-17T00:00:00Z[9]. His father was Antony Gathorne-Hardy[10]. His mother was Ruth Thorowgood[11].

Education

Educated at University of Cambridge[17], a collegiate university[28], in United Kingdom[29], founded in 1209[30], headquartered in Cambridge[31]; Bryanston School[18], an independent school[32], in United Kingdom[33], founded in 1928[34]; and Port Regis School[19], a school[35], in United Kingdom[36], founded in 1881[37].

Career and Affiliations

Recorded occupations include writer[6] and biographer[7].

Personal Life

Spouses include Sabrina Tennant[12], b. 1943[38] and Nicky Loutit[13]. Children include Jenny Gathorne-Hardy[14] and Benjamin Gathorne-Hardy[15].

Death and Burial

Jonathan Gathorne-Hardy died on +2019-07-16T00:00:00Z[5]. He died in Aldeburgh[4].
